Closed Bug 1316762 Opened 8 years ago Closed 8 years ago

Add fuzzy annotation for box-sizing-replaced-003.xht on linux

Categories

(Core :: Layout, defect)

defect
Not set
normal

Tracking

()

RESOLVED FIXED
mozilla52
Tracking Status
firefox52 --- fixed

People

(Reporter: dholbert, Unassigned)

References

Details

Attachments

(1 file)

Filing this bug on annotating box-sizing-replaced-003.xht as fuzzy on linux, since it becomes fuzzy there when we reduce the paint delay (bug 1283302).

Failures look like:
{
REFTEST TEST-UNEXPECTED-FAIL | [...]/box-sizing-replaced-003-ref.xht | image comparison, max difference: 14, number of differing pixels: 43
}
https://treeherder.mozilla.org/logviewer.html#?job_id=39017948&repo=mozilla-inbound#L27106

The reftest snapshot shows that it's just a few fuzzy pixels at the edge of a shape in a scaled image. Not a particularly unexpected sort of artifact, when image scaling is going on. And it looks like we hit this elsewhere (and annotated this exact test as fuzzy on Android) in bug 1128229.

So, we should be fine to annotate it as fuzzy on Linux as well.  We might need an across-the-board fuzzy annotation, but let's start conservatively.
(I'm not filing this as an intermittent bug, because we already have one for this test -- bug 1146002. I don't think the failure mode here is quite the same as that one, but I also don't think we gain much from having multiple intermittent bugs open for the same test, or for landing this targeted fuzzy annotation on the more-severe bug 1146002.)
(I think the existing comment on the reftest.list line here -- which points to bug 1128229 -- is sufficient to explain the fuzzy annotation, too -- that's why I didn't add a new bug link there. That bug (bug 1128229) is about fuzziness due to "failure to call imgFrame::Optimize before the reftest snapshot is taken", and I expect that's what's causing the image-scaling-fuzziness here, too.)
Comment on attachment 8809646 [details]
Bug 1316762: Add fuzzy annotation for box-sizing-replaced-003.xht on linux.

https://reviewboard.mozilla.org/r/92188/#review92172
Attachment #8809646 - Flags: review?(npancholi) → review+
Pushed by dholbert@mozilla.com:
https://hg.mozilla.org/integration/mozilla-inbound/rev/fec4c0269a82
Add fuzzy annotation for box-sizing-replaced-003.xht on linux. r=neerja
https://hg.mozilla.org/mozilla-central/rev/fec4c0269a82
Status: NEW → RESOLVED
Closed: 8 years ago
Resolution: --- → FIXED
Target Milestone: --- → mozilla52
You need to log in before you can comment on or make changes to this bug.

Attachment

General

Created:
Updated:
Size: